随着互联网的发展,越来越多的企业选择将业务迁移到云端。由于DDoS攻击频发,云服务器的安全问题日益凸显。为了有效防范DDoS攻击,保障企业的正常运营,做好云服务器的安全配置至关重要。
一、了解DDoS攻击的特点和原理
DDoS(Distributed Denial of Service)即分布式拒绝服务攻击,是指攻击者利用大量的傀儡机(肉鸡)向目标服务器发送海量请求,导致服务器资源耗尽或网络带宽占满,最终使合法用户无法正常访问服务。DDoS攻击具有突发性强、持续时间长、流量大等特点。常见的DDoS攻击类型包括UDP Flood、SYN Flood、HTTP Flood等。其中,UDP Flood是通过向目标服务器发送大量UDP包来消耗其处理能力;SYN Flood则是利用TCP三次握手协议中的漏洞,使服务器处于半连接状态,从而占用系统资源;而HTTP Flood则更隐蔽,它模拟正常的HTTP请求,但频率极高,难以与正常流量区分开来。
二、选择可靠的云服务商
选择一家有良好口碑和技术实力的云服务商是确保云服务器安全的基础。优质的云服务商通常会提供专业的安全防护措施,如高防IP、流量清洗、入侵检测等。在选择时,可以参考以下几点:
1. 服务稳定性:查看该服务商的历史宕机记录,优先选择长期稳定运行的服务商;
2. 安全性能:了解其提供的安全产品和服务是否完善,例如是否有专业的安全团队负责监控和响应攻击事件;
3. 技术支持:遇到问题时能否得到及时有效的帮助也非常重要。在签订合同前要询问清楚客服的工作时间、响应速度等情况。
三、合理配置防火墙规则
防火墙作为云服务器的第一道防线,能够有效阻止非法访问并过滤掉部分恶意流量。对于Linux系统的云服务器来说,iptables是一个非常强大的工具,用户可以根据实际需求自定义规则。例如,限制某些IP地址段的访问权限、设置特定端口只允许内部网络内的设备连接等。还可以开启ICMP洪水攻击防护功能,当检测到异常高的ICMP请求时自动屏蔽来源IP。
四、启用负载均衡与弹性伸缩
当遭受大规模DDoS攻击时,单台服务器可能很快就会不堪重负。如果启用了负载均衡,则可以将流量分散到多台服务器上,减轻每台机器的压力。结合弹性伸缩技术,根据当前业务量动态调整实例数量,保证在高峰期有足够的计算资源可用,而在低谷期又能节省成本。这样既能提高抗压能力,又不会浪费资源。
五、定期进行漏洞扫描与补丁更新
软件中存在的漏洞往往是黑客发动攻击的重要途径之一。企业应该建立完善的漏洞管理机制,定期使用专业工具对云服务器及其应用程序进行扫描,及时发现潜在风险。一旦发现问题,要尽快联系开发商获取修复方案或者自行打上官方发布的安全补丁。也要关注开源社区里关于所用组件的新版本发布信息,尽早升级至最新稳定版。
六、加强日志审计与异常监测
良好的日志管理系统有助于追溯攻击源头,并为后续改进提供依据。建议开启详细的访问日志记录功能,保留足够长的时间以便事后分析。部署专门的日志分析平台,通过设定阈值等方式实现对异常行为的实时告警。比如,当某段时间内某个API接口被频繁调用次数超过正常范围时,就触发警报通知管理员检查是否存在恶意爬虫或撞库行为。
七、制定应急预案
尽管采取了诸多预防措施,但仍有可能遭遇严重的DDoS攻击。这时候就需要有一套完善的应急预案来指导相关人员快速做出反应。预案内容应涵盖以下几个方面:
1. 明确职责分工,确定谁负责协调指挥、谁负责技术处理、谁负责对外沟通等工作;
2. 规定应急流程,如启动备用服务器切换、联系云服务商寻求协助等具体步骤;
3. 准备好必要的工具和文档,如网络拓扑图、常用命令手册等,以提高工作效率。
面对日益猖獗的DDoS攻击,云服务器的安全防护工作任重道远。除了上述提到的几项措施外,还应不断学习新的技术和理念,保持警惕之心,才能真正构建起一道坚固的安全屏障,为企业数字化转型保驾护航。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/192484.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。